sql >> Databasteknik >  >> RDS >> Mysql

Hur tar man bort flera rader från mysql-databasen med kryssrutan med PHP?

inkludera alla inmatningselement i din

taggar: alla ingångar finns här

uppdatering:

<input name = "checkbox[]" type="checkbox"  id="checkbox[]" value="<?php echo     $rows['course_code'];?>">

till (id spelar ingen roll här):

<input name="checkbox[]" type="checkbox"  value="<?php echo $rows['course_code'];?>"/>

och din knappkod:

<input type='button' id="delete" value='Delete' name='delete'>

till

<input type="submit" value="Delete"/>

ställ in öppning

tagga till

Obs:Jag antar att nedanstående koder finns i filen delete.php. om inte, ersätt "delete.php" med det namnet i ovanstående öppningsformulärtagg.

din delete.php-fil:

<?php
$cheks = implode("','", $_POST['checkbox']);
$sql = "delete from $tbl_name where course_code in ('$cheks')";
$result = mysql_query($sql) or die(mysql_error());
mysql_close();
?>

Obs! Eftersom mysql_ kommer att fasas ut i framtiden, bättre är att använda mysqli-tillägget . Men innan du använder det måste du aktivera det på din server. mysqli är en del av php och nyare version av php har det men inte aktiverat. För att aktivera detta, se php-informationssidan och hitta sökvägen till php.ini-filen i raden "Laddad konfigurationsfil" på den sidan. Du kan se php-informationssidan genom att ladda nedanstående php-fil i webbläsaren:

<?php
 phpinfo();
?>

öppna den php.ini-filen i en textredigerare och av-kommentera eller lägg till en rad extension=php_mysqli.dll i tilläggslistan där. sök också efter "extension_dir" och öppna katalogen som det står och se till att filen php_mysqli.dll finns där.(du kan ha tillägget .so om du inte använder Windows OS)

Starta sedan om din server och du är klar!

Av Fred -ii-



  1. Vad är ett bra sätt att trimma alla blanksteg från en sträng i T-SQL utan UDF och utan CLR?

  2. uWSGI, Flask, sqlalchemy och postgres:SSL-fel:dekryptering misslyckades eller dålig registrering mac

  3. Spring-Boot, kan inte spara unicode-sträng i MySql med spring-data JPA

  4. Hur man hämtar ER-modell av databas från server med Workbench